Each dwelling is placed in one of eight Council Tax bands (A to H), with dwellings in band H being the most expensive. The Council Tax band reflects the Assessor’s opinion of open market value, subject to a number of statutory assumptions. subway jeffers rd eau claire

Web1 de abr. de 1991 · Council Tax Band Property Value at 1 April 1991. A – property valuation up to £40,000. B – property valuation £40,001 – £52,000. C – property valuation £52,001 – £68,000. D – property valuation £68,001 – £88,000. E – property valuation £88,001 – £120,000. F – property valuation £120,001 – £160,000. G ...
